Agora Deposit: J 2:13
Title:   Hellenistic Pyre
Category:   Pyre
Keyword:   Archaic-Classical
Description:   Hellenistic Pyre below packed clay floors of Room 2; west of Late Roman wall extension, below tile platform terracotta drain installation, bordered on the north by bedding foundation stones of crosswall between rooms 2 and 3.
Contents:   Pyre pots mostly smashed, in a layer of ash and carbon defined as half of a circle.
Notes:   Dated by S. Rotroff.
Bibliography:   Hesperia Suppl. 47 (2013), no. 8, p. 111, figs. 22, 23, 33.
Chronology:   Ca. 300 B.C.
